I am not sure why the New Yorker thought it germane to satirize Vanilla Ice as a business consultant. Is he making some sort of comeback of which I am unaware? Still, the satire is funny.
But as my friend Guy Tower pointed out to me, Vanilla Ice is actually a moderately successful businessman in real estate. He buys homes in Florida, fixes them up and flips them. You can get his advice on TV! If you really want to know, go to vanillaicerealestate.com.
“Stop, renovate and list them,” quoth the Tower.
